5 Quick Tips to Boost Your Mood and Longevity

If you are in need of a pick-me-up these days, you don’t have to splurge on a new pair of shoes or break your bank account. Instead, you can lift your spirits with some simple tips that will turn your frown upside down and kick up your energy a few notches!

 

1. Stand Up for Happiness

As much as we like to feel accomplished and ensure that we are being productive, all too often we can spiral down into a working whirlwind. Sitting at the desk all day and staring into the screen can zap you of your energy and drain your mood. To get out of your rut, all you have to do is get back on your feet! Yes, it is as simple as taking a few moments to stand tall, stretch your arms, and wiggle your toes and fingers. A boost in circulation will deliver much needed oxygen-rich blood to your cells. You will feel an instant surge of energy and while you’re reaching for the stars, turn that frown upside down. A smile will trigger the release of serotonin, the feel-good brain chemical that will instantly perk up your mood!

2. Think Positive

Stress can wreak havoc on our thoughts and behavior. Negative thought patterns may eventually contribute to depression, anxiety, and possibly an unfulfilling lifestyle. On the flip side, more positive thoughts can instantly lift your spirits and change your outlook. Try the following exercise: each day write down at least three things for which you are grateful. Your mind will instantly tune into a positive channel and you will begin to focus on the blessings in your life. Instead of dragging yourself down with what you wish you had, boost your mood by acknowledging all the things that you do have at this moment. You will begin to see that your glass is half full with abundance!

3. Crank Up the Radio

There is nothing like your favorite tune to instantly make you feel like a rock star! Whether you enjoy jazz or the latest pop, studies indicate that listening or creating music can potentially treat depression, autism, and help in pain management. Try to listen to music that triggers happy thoughts and memories or calms you when you are feeling stressed. After a few minutes you may find the urge to shimmy--or perhaps enjoy a deep meditation. Whatever your choice may be, make sure to have your favorite go-to list of tunes on handy for an instant lift!

4. Be Rainbow Bright

If your closet is full of gray and black, it may be time to add a splash of color. Just changing out of your usual monochrome dark colors can instantly lift your spirits. In particular, bright shades of red, pink, and yellow are best for stimulating your brain. You don’t have to toss your favorite gray shirt for a wardrobe that looks like a Crayola box! Adding just one or two brighter items to your closet is all you may need to color your mood happy.

5. Carbs Count

Another great and delicious way to boost the levels of serotonin in you brain is to munch on some healthy carbs. To get the health benefits you crave, it is best to stick with whole grains and fruit. Pass on the processed chips and sweet treats for carbohydrates that will provide you with the slow release of energy you need to carry you through the day. If you’re feeling blue, try snacking on about 30 grams of good carbs, which is just the right amount to give you the lift you need:

• ½ whole grain toast with 1 tbs nut butter and ½ cup of berries

• ½ cup oatmeal with a handful of unsalted nuts and dried cranberries

• 1 banana
